What are the steps involved in Decisioning Process?

Following are the steps involved in Decisioning Process :

  • Step 1: Begin the tree with the root node, says S, which contains the complete dataset.
  • Step 2: Find the best attribute in the dataset using the Attribute Selection Measure (ASM).
  • Step 3: Divide the S into subsets that contain possible values for the best attributes.
  • Step 4: Generate the decision tree node, which contains the best attribute.
  • Step 5: Recursively make new decision trees using the subsets of the dataset created in step -3. Continue this process until a stage is reached where you cannot further classify the nodes and called the final node as a leaf node.
